Wei Ye is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Computer Networks and Communications. According to data from OpenAlex, Wei Ye has authored 41 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Artificial Intelligence, 12 papers in Computer Vision and Pattern Recognition and 7 papers in Computer Networks and Communications. Recurrent topics in Wei Ye's work include Topic Modeling (17 papers), Natural Language Processing Techniques (13 papers) and Multimodal Machine Learning Applications (7 papers). Wei Ye is often cited by papers focused on Topic Modeling (17 papers), Natural Language Processing Techniques (13 papers) and Multimodal Machine Learning Applications (7 papers). Wei Ye collaborates with scholars based in China, United States and Cayman Islands. Wei Ye's co-authors include Yidong Wang, Jindong Wang, Xing Xie, Hao Chen, Yi Chang, Qiang Yang, Cunxiang Wang, Xiaoyuan Yi, Xu Wang and Yuan Wu and has published in prestigious journals such as International Journal of Computer Vision, IEEE Transactions on Knowledge and Data Engineering and ACM Transactions on Intelligent Systems and Technology.
